How to buy one
Gift cards are purchased through the same online booking system used for appointments. Pick an amount, add a message, and it is delivered digitally. You do not need to choose a specific service, which is usually the right call unless you know exactly what they want.
What amount to pick
For a specific treat: $65 covers a facial, a lash lift or a brow appointment with room to spare. $70 covers brow lamination. $145 covers a classic lash full set, $200 a volume set. $25 to $80 covers tooth gems depending on the design. For someone who already has lashes, the kindest gift is a fill or two at $65 to $85 each.
Using one
The recipient books online like anyone else and applies the gift card at checkout, or mentions it when texting to book. If they are new, point them at the new client guide first so they know how to prep.
